利用buffer构建CImage有时工作上习惯于照猫画虎工作只求过得去不求过得硬存在着求稳怕乱的思想和患得患失心理导致工作上不能完全放开手脚甩开膀子去干缺少一种敢于负责的担当和气魄 1. 2. 3. 4. /***/ #include <atlimage.h> //.读入 Mat 矩阵(cvMat 一),Mat img=imread("*.*");//cvLoadImage ...
CVPixelBufferRef :A reference to a Core Video pixel buffer object. The pixel buffer stores an image in main memory. 从上述可知,CVPixelBuffer『继承了』CVImageBuffer,然而,由于Core Video暴露出来的是Objective-C接口,意味着若想用C语言实现『面向对象的继承』,则CVPixelBuffer的数据成员定义位置与CVImageBu...
re: 用CImage加载内存里的Image (II)[未登录] 06年的时候有过用CImage加载内存里的图片的需求,当时是这样做的。 多年后,再次看这个问题,发现更简单的办法: voidLoadImage(void* pBuffer,intnSize, CImage& img) { COleStreamFile osf; osf.CreateMemoryStream(NULL); osf.Write(pBuffer, nSize); osf.See...
#include<graphics.h>#include<conio.h>intmain(){IMAGEim;// 图像变量loadimage(&im,_T("pic1.jpg"));// 导入图像文件intwidth,height;// 图片的宽度、高度,也是屏幕的宽度、高度width=im.getwidth();// 获得图像的宽度height=im.getheight();// 获得图像的高度DWORD*pMem=GetImageBuffer(&im);// 获...
Image 最后没有被放到cbuffer里的全局变量会被打包到$Global这个全局的默认的cbuffer里 Shader Constants (HLSL) - Win32 apps | Microsoft Learn 例如在 Unity DX11 后端下,Shader 中写成下面这种 half4 _Color; 编译后这个变量会被打包到$Global里
(1) 创建一个默认的单文档程序项目Ex_Image。 (2) 打开stdafx.h文件中添加CImage类的包含文件atlimage.h。 (3) 在CEx_ImageView类添加ID_FILE_OPEN的COMMAND事件映射程序,并添加下列代码: void CEx_ImageView::OnFileOpen() { CString strFilter;
outputBuffer:存储转换后的BASE64编码字符串 返回值: -1:参数错误 >=0:有效编码长度(字符数),不包括字符串结束符。 备注: 等效于openssl中EVP_EncodeBlock函数*/INT BASE64_Encode(constBYTE* inputBuffer, INT inputCount, TCHAR*outputBuffer );/*功能:将BASE64编码字符串转换为二进制数据 ...
define BUFFER_SIZE 100000 // 可根据实际图像大小调整 int main() { FILE *file;char *buffer;long fileLength;// 打开.raw文件 file = fopen("image.raw", "rb");if (!file) { printf("无法打开文件。\n");return 1;} // 获取文件大小 fseek(file, 0, SEEK_END);fileLength = ftell...
图片缩放 本模块提供图片细节增强的的C API接口,通过调用本模块,可以实现图片内容的清晰度增强及缩放功能,处理后的数据可以用于送显和编码保存。 典型应用场景如:图片解码获取图片buffer &g……欲了解更多信息欢迎访问华为HarmonyOS开发者官网
将接收到的BMP图像内存数据存入CImage并显示 #include <windows.h> #include <string> #include <atlimage.h> static int Bytes2Image(CImage& image, const std::string strBuffer) { BYTE* pData = (BYTE*)strBuffer.c_str(); //TODO:存入CImage...